Job Description

  • Job Description
  • Job Summary:
  • Under general supervision, use specialized knowledge and skills obtained through experience and/or training to assist with the overall management of an assigned functional area, including collaborating with the management team to identify opportunities for operational efficiency, productivity improvements and assisting with special projects.

May train or lead the work of other associates or supervise highly routine work. Detailed instructions and established procedures and prescribed guidelines are provided to perform a variety of tasks requiring some evaluation, originality or ingenuity in making routine decisions. Recommends solutions to moderately complex problems. Provide support and assistance on projects and job functions within the department. Associate will be responsible for assisting department training including the maintenance of the department training tools.

  •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
  • + Monitors workflows to ensure assignments are completed in an accurate and timely manner.

+ Provide support and direction to incoming callers regarding operational requirements, processes, policies and time frames. + Facilitate training of associates and provide education to branch associates on the use of applications and system enhancements. + Extensive contact with internal customers and external contacts is required to identify, research, and resolve problems. + Demonstrate department procedures and functionality to visiting branch and home-office support staff. + Provide and/or coordinate cross-training, coaching and mentoring. Serve as a back-up in cross-functional responsibilities during absences. + Assist in research, develop, revise and maintain department on-line training manual as needs dictates. + Assist with the implementation of new ideas to increase job performance and production. + Monitor and resolve issues related to regulations regarding client accounts, to identify potential problems or status of high risk accounts and situations. + Provide input to supervisor regarding prioritization of assignments on a regular basis. + Prepares written recaps, reports and spreadsheets for special projects and submits to management for review. + Initiates efficiency and productivity improvements. + Performs other duties, special projects and responsibilities as assigned.
